Barrington Memorial Day Service: 11 a.m. Monday, May 31, Evergreen Cemetery, 610 S. Dundee Ave., Barrington. While there will be no Memorial Day parade this year in Barrington, join veterans for the traditional Memorial Day service at Evergreen Cemetery. In addition to several speakers and a moving ceremony, volunteers from the Signal Hill Chapter, NSDAR, will be on hand at the gathering to share information on Wreaths Across America, which will take place for the third year at the cemetery on Satudaughtersrday, Dec. 18. Fox River Grove Memorial Day parade: 8:30 a.m. Monday, May 31. Parade starts at Algonquin Road School and continues down Algonquin Road to South River Road to the baseball diamond along the Fox River in Lions Park. Visit www.foxrivergrove-il.org.
Palatine American Legion Post 690 Memorial Day programs: 10 a.m. Monday, May 31, Hillside Cemetery, 375 N. Smith St.; 11 a.m. at Veterans Memorial, corner of Northwest Highway and Wood Street; 12:15 p.m. at Legion Memorial, 150 W. Palatine Road, in Towne Square, all in Palatine. American Legion Post 690 will hold a 10 a.m. service at Hillside Cemetery, followed by a short program at 11 a.m. at the Veterans Memorial and then another ceremony at the Legion Memorial in Towne Square beginning at 12:15 p.m. Community members are invited to the American Legion, 122 W. Palatine Road, across the street from Towne Square, following the ceremonies. There will be no parade and no band because of the pandemic. Social distancing and masks will be required at all three ceremonies. The American Legion will be selling American flags from its clubroom. Flags are $20. West Dundee Memorial Day Service: 11:30 a.m. Monday, May 31, River Valley Memorial Gardens, 14N689 Route 31, West Dundee. Free. Visit www.rivervalleymemorialgardens.com. On Friday, May 28, they will be placing American flags on veterans’ graves starting at 9 a.m.
